§ 76-12a24 — Use of buildings and land for placement of persons in custody of secretary of corrections; supervision and security; agreements

Text
The secretary for aging and disability services is authorized to enter into an agreement with the secretary of corrections concerning the management and utilization of buildings and land currently not being used at state institutions under the authority of the secretary for aging and disability services for the placement of persons in the custody of the secretary of corrections. The secretary of corrections shall provide supervision and security for persons placed under any such agreement.

Legislative History
L. 1984, ch. 302, § 1; L. 2015, ch. 56, § 8; May 21.
